Surveillance de la base de données

La fonction de surveillance de la base de données permet d'exécuter une requête lors de chaque vérification et de réagir de manière appropriée au résultat. Il est également possible de vérifier uniquement la possibilité de se connecter à la base de données - en ignorant le champ de la requête. Pour configurer la surveillance, remplissez les données de connexion : adresse du serveur de la base de données, port, nom de la base de données, login et mot de passe d'un utilisateur pour la connexion. Nous recommandons fortement de créer un nouvel utilisateur avec des droits limités. Cependant, n'oubliez pas de lui donner suffisamment de droits pour qu'il puisse effectuer les actions prévues. Il est également nécessaire d'ajouter les adresses des serveurs HostTracker aux listes blanches du pare-feu ou d'autres logiciels de blocage, afin d'autoriser l'accès. Les adresses sont permanentes et figurent sur le même formulaire.

Create ContentCheck Task

Il peut s'agir d'une requête arbitraire - SELECT, UPDATE, DELETE, INSERT, de l'exécution de procédures stockées (comme le planificateur), de la comparaison de résultats, d'opérations logiques. La seule restriction est le temps d'exécution - il ne doit pas prendre plus de 30 secondes. Dans le cas contraire, une erreur de dépassement de délai sera signalée.

Il est recommandé de créer des requêtes qui affichent la valeur nécessaire dans la première ligne de la première colonne. Ce résultat peut être analysé. Pour les requêtes UPDATE, INSERT, DELETE, le nombre de lignes affectées est analysé. Il existe différentes manières d'analyser la valeur obtenue en la comparant à des paramètres spécifiques prédéfinis - égal/pas égal/plus haut/plus bas/à l'intérieur d'une fourchette. Si la condition n'est pas remplie, pas de connexion à la base de données, dépassement du délai de la requête, l'erreur est signalée.

Create ContentCheck Task